Ellen Yin is the founder and co-owner of High Street Hospitality Group (HSHG), a prominent hospitality group in Philadelphia’s culinary scene. Since its inception, HSHG has been instrumental in operating several acclaimed dining establishments, including its flagship Fork, High Street Restaurant & Bakery, a.kitchen+bar in Philadelphia and a.kitchen+bar DC, and The Wonton Project. In 2023, she was named “Outstanding Restaurateur” by the James Beard Foundation. Proudly dedicated to the flourishing of Philadelphia, Ellen is a co-chair of Sisterly Love Collective and a board member of the Philadelphia Award, the Delaware River Waterfront Corporation, and the Arden Theater Company. She is on the Community Advisory Board of the Thomas Jefferson University Hospital Kimmel Cancer Center. Nationally, she sits on the Restaurant Advisory Board of OpenTable. She earned her undergraduate degree and MBA from Wharton School of the University of Pennsylvania.
